Java 在执行gRPC客户端流时,服务器在未接收到所有请求时的行为如何

Java 在执行gRPC客户端流时,服务器在未接收到所有请求时的行为如何,java,protocol-buffers,grpc,grpc-java,Java,Protocol Buffers,Grpc,Grpc Java,我想知道客户端将要进行数据流处理的场景。在此过程中,它将发送三个请求。让我们假设服务器将只接收两个 在当前情况下,服务器将如何反应?我猜服务器永远不会通知客户端已完成的请求(它知道预期的请求数),并且只要定义了截止日期,进程就会终止。我的假设有效吗 我正在研究gRPC的Java实现。没错。如果服务器正在等待从未收到的第三个请求,则呼叫将在截止日期前终止。我编写了一个简单的测试,服务器将等待客户端完成

我想知道客户端将要进行数据流处理的场景。在此过程中,它将发送三个请求。让我们假设服务器将只接收两个

在当前情况下,服务器将如何反应?我猜服务器永远不会通知客户端已完成的请求(它知道预期的请求数),并且只要定义了截止日期,进程就会终止。我的假设有效吗


我正在研究gRPC的Java实现。

没错。如果服务器正在等待从未收到的第三个请求,则呼叫将在截止日期前终止。

我编写了一个简单的测试,服务器将等待客户端完成